C220 head

Hi Im new here, I have a 1994 C220 with M111 motor that has blown a head gasket. I am an ex motor mechanic but have never worked on Mercedes. I decided to do the repairs myself and a billion bolts nuts and thingies later I have it stripped down to the final stage of head removal. My problem is that the bolts on the exhaust camshaft sprocket, the cambering and the head studs themselves are so tight I can't undo them. Has anyone else struck this and is there a workaround? They are all torx head bolts and I have broken a couple of drivers on the cam socket as the torx drivers are so tiny. Any help would be appreciated. First time here. Thanks in advance

Just buy a good quality torx socket, T40 i think...they do sit tight as they are stretch bolts, another option maybe to remove the tensioner and the bearing caps so you can just remove the camshaft complete

I have bought good quality Torx but the bolts are just so tight. Is there some trick to breaking them free?

Tap them several times with a hammer to shock them. Or use a power bar on the bolt keeping tension on it smack the rear of the power bar it may shock it loose
